Data analysis in trading is a crucial aspect that underpins the decision-making process of traders and investors in financial markets. It involves the systematic evaluation of financial data to discern patterns, correlations, and trends that can inform trading strategies. In an increasingly data-driven world, where vast amounts of information are generated every second, the ability to analyze and interpret this data effectively has become more important than ever. This analysis can lead to more informed decisions, reduced risk, and ultimately, improved financial performance.
At its core, data analysis in trading is about understanding historical price movements and other relevant variables. By studying past performance, traders can identify recurring trends that may signal future price behavior. Various techniques are utilized in this analytical process, ranging from basic statistical methods to advanced machine learning algorithms. Technical analysis, for example, involves the use of charts and indicators to predict future market movements based on historical data. Fundamental analysis, on the other hand, looks at economic indicators, financial statements, and other qualitative and quantitative factors that can affect the value of a security.
One of the key components of data analysis in trading is the collection of data itself. Traders collect data from a wide range of sources, including stock exchanges, financial news outlets, and economic reports. This data can encompass price movements, trading volumes, interest rates, and economic indicators like GDP growth and unemployment rates. Today, even social media trends and sentiment analysis play a role in data collection, as traders look for any potential influence on market dynamics.
Once the data is gathered, it undergoes a rigorous process of cleaning and structuring to ensure accuracy and relevance. High-quality data is essential for effective analysis. Analysts must deal with issues such as missing data points, outliers, and data noise, which can skew results. Once the data is prepared, various statistical techniques are applied to derive insights. This may include calculating moving averages, correlation coefficients, and regression analyses. By doing so, traders can develop models that predict how certain factors might influence asset prices.
The rise of algorithmic trading has transformed the landscape of data analysis in trading. Algorithmic trading uses automated systems that implement trading strategies based on predefined criteria derived from data analysis. These algorithms can process vast amounts of information at speeds unattainable by human traders, enabling them to respond to market changes almost instantaneously. The effectiveness of these algorithms hinges on the robustness of the data analysis methods used; a well-analyzed data set can significantly enhance the performance of trading algorithms.
Additionally, machine learning and artificial intelligence (AI) have emerged as powerful tools in the realm of trading data analysis. These technologies can uncover complex patterns within large datasets that traditional statistical methods may overlook. For instance, machine learning algorithms can learn from historical trading data to make predictions about future price movements. By training these algorithms on advanced models, traders can enhance their predictive capabilities and better navigate market volatility.
Risk management is another crucial facet of data analysis in trading. By analyzing various data points, traders can better understand potential risk factors associated with their investments. Techniques such as Value at Risk (VaR) or stress testing allow traders to estimate potential losses in different market conditions. Engaging in comprehensive risk analysis enables traders to implement more effective hedging strategies, thereby safeguarding their investments against unforeseen market swings.
The advent of data visualization tools also plays a significant role in data analysis in trading. These tools help traders and analysts visualize complex data sets in an understandable and interpretable manner. Graphs, charts, and dashboards facilitate the analysis process, allowing users to quickly spot trends, anomalies, or critical insights. Effective data visualization can significantly enhance the decision-making process, as it enables quicker assessments of market conditions.
Moreover, backtesting is a vital component of data analysis in trading. Backtesting involves applying trading strategies to historical data to evaluate their effectiveness. By analyzing how a strategy would have performed in the past, traders can gain insights into its potential success in real-time markets. This practice minimizes the risks associated with new strategies by ensuring a solid empirical foundation prior to implementation.
In conclusion, data analysis in trading encompasses a comprehensive suite of techniques and methodologies aimed at optimizing trading performance and managing risk. It combines historical data evaluation, statistical analysis, advanced technologies, and visualization tools to create a holistic understanding of market dynamics. As traders increasingly rely on data-driven insights, the integration of sophisticated tools such as machine learning, AI, and algorithmic trading continues to evolve, promising even greater enhancements in the art and science of trading. The future of data analysis in trading looks promising, offering new avenues for traders to navigate the complexities of financial markets and achieve their investment goals more effectively.